Item 5. Market for Registrant’s Common Equity, Related Stockholder Matters and Issuer Purchases of Equity Securities
The Company’s common stock is traded on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ol “WWW.” The number of stockholders of record on February 6, 2026, was 596.
A quarterly dividend of $0.10 per share was declared on February 11, 2026. The Company currently expects that comparable cash dividends will be paid in future quarters in fiscal 2026.
Stock Performance Graph
The following graph compares the five-year cumulative total stockholder return on the Company’s common stock to the S&P Composite 1500 Index and the S&P Composite 1500 Consumer Durables & Apparel Index, assuming an investment of $100 at the beginning of the period indicated and reinvestment of dividends. The Company is part of both the S&P 1500 Index and the S&P 1500 Consumer Durables & Apparel Index. (1) On March 7, 2024, the Company’s Board of Directors approved a common stock repurchase program that authorized the repurchase of $150.0 million of common stock over a three-year period.
(2) Employee transactions include restricted shares and units withheld to offset statutory minimum tax withholding that occurs upon vesting of restricted shares and units. The Company’s employee stock compensation plans provide that the shares withheld shall be valued at the closing price of the Company’s common stock on the date the relevant transaction occurs.
